Finance Minister Aims for Export-led Growth in Budget 2026-27

Advertisement

Finance Minister Muhammad Aurangzeb unveiled the Federal Budget 2026-27, aimed at fostering export-led, sustainable and inclusive economic growth. He emphasized expanding the tax base and supporting key productive sectors without overburdening existing taxpayers.

The budget includes measures to boost productivity and create employment opportunities, with a focus on broadening and deepening the tax net alongside reforms for equity and fairness in taxation. Tax relief measures are set for salaried individuals, small businesses, export and construction sectors, while concessional financing is introduced for agriculture and exports.

Aurangzeb highlighted the “Zarkhez” scheme providing interest-free and collateral-free loans worth Rs300 billion to around 750,000 small farmers, and the Prime Minister’s Youth Business and Agriculture Loan Scheme offering Rs109 billion in loans. Import duty relief worth Rs2 billion was introduced for agricultural modernization, with duties on machinery and equipment abolished.

The budget has received positive feedback from both inside and outside parliament, with key economic indicators showing improvement including 6.5% growth in large-scale manufacturing and a current account surplus during the first 11 months of the fiscal year. Remittances reached $4.25 billion last month, expected to touch $41 billion for the full year, while IT exports grew by 20%, reaching a projected $4.5 billion.

The National Assembly held detailed discussions on charged expenditures, including pensions, parliament, judiciary, debt repayments, and other constitutional institutions. Minister of Parliamentary Affairs Dr Tariq Fazal Chaudhry urged constructive engagement from the opposition to strengthen parliament, while Minister of State for Law Aqeel Malik rejected objections to charged expenditures, emphasizing reforms for speedy justice. The House will meet again on Sunday at 11am.
